Method
Candied Pecans
- 1
Prepare the Candied Pecans
In a skillet over medium heat, melt the butter. Add the pecans, brown sugar, and a pinch of salt. Stir continuously for about 5 minutes until the pecans are coated and caramelized. Remove from heat and let cool.
Banana Rum Caramel Sauce
- 2
Make the Caramel Sauce
In a saucepan over medium heat, combine brown sugar, heavy cream, and butter. Stir until the mixture comes to a simmer. Allow to cook for 3-5 minutes until thickened. Remove from heat and stir in banana liqueur and rum.
French Toast Preparation
- 3
Prepare the Egg Mixture
In a mixing bowl, whisk together eggs, milk, vanilla extract, and ground cinnamon until well combined.
- 4
Soak the Bread
Dip each slice of ciabatta bread into the egg mixture, ensuring both sides are coated. Let excess drip off.
